Why did God reprove Eli?
Answer
"In that day I will perform against Eli all things which I have spoken concerning his house: when I begin, I
will also make an end. For I have told him that I will judge his house for ever for the iniquity which he
knoweth; because his sons made themselves vile, and he restrained them not." 1 Sam. 3:12,13.
